A Briefing for Senior Managers, Compliance, Risk, Legal & HR

Join Kenneth Underhill and Jason Jones of ICSR and Lucinda Carney of Actus for a discussion on the Senior Managers Certification Regime, looking at the future for FCA regulated firms from the perspective of senior managers, including compliance, risk, legal and HR managers.

The agenda will cover the background to the new regulations, a look at the practical requirements for firms and a discussion on how to embed the ethos of SMCR through genuine cultural change around personal responsibility.

Agenda:

  • SMCR for Senior Managers – what it means for the senior management: a session for senior managers, compliance officers, general counsels, risk officers and HR personnel on the impact of personal responsibilities. (Kenneth Underhill)
  • SMCR: The Practical requirements – what is required and some helpful hints: a session for compliance officers, general counsels, risk officers and HR personnel. (Jason Jones)
  • Embedding the ethos of SMCR: How to deliver genuine cultural change around personal responsibility. How Compliance and HR functions should work together to integrate this. (Lucinda Carney)
